Overview
- Vidarbha secured a 128-run first-innings lead after posting 342 and bowling Rest of India out for 214 in 69.5 overs.
- Atharva Taide’s 143 and Yash Rathod’s 91 underpinned Vidarbha’s total, setting up control of the match.
- Rajat Patidar top-scored for Rest of India with 66 and Abhimanyu Easwaran added 52 in an innings derailed by Yash Thakur.
- Aditya Thakare struck with the day’s first ball as Manav Suthar was given lbw on review after an initial not-out call.
- Play ended early due to bad light, with Vidarbha 96 for 2 as Dhruv Shorey and Danish Malewar guided them to an overall lead of 224 heading into Day 4.
